What memories do you have of last summer at Valderrama? <\/strong><br \/>-I have many memories. The first one that comes to mind is obviously the last hole, making the putt to win the tournament. The course is spectacular. Andalusia is a beautiful region. I had my family there with me. It was fun to beat Bryson there on the last hole, and the fans are incredible. There were a lot of expectations, of the course and how the week would go. And I have to admit it lived up to it. So we\u2019re looking forward to going back.        <br \/><strong>-How do you approach the weekend and what did you learn from last year that will help you play better this year? <\/strong><br \/>-Knowing that I\u2019ve played well there, it\u2019s nice to go back to a place where you\u2019ve played well. It gives you confidence and obviously I like the course, especially the greens. It fits my style of play, with my particular way of hitting the ball. <br \/><strong>-This is your third team in three years, so you\u2019re really mixing it with some of the greats in golf. You\u2019ve already achieved success in the individual championship \u2013 are you looking at taking the team title?  <\/strong><br \/>-The first year, when we won the team championship in Miami with the 4Aces, I thought there was nothing sweeter than celebrating a team win, right? So that\u2019s the goal and we\u2019ve been talking all year as a team that we want to win it all. It\u2019s going to be a fun second half of the season. And hopefully we can get to play well heading into that last event.   <br \/><strong>-Outside the field, what are you most looking forward to back in Spain?<\/strong><br \/>-Good food, good wine and being there with my family and friends. As I said, this part of the world is beautiful. Launched in 2022, the League was designed to expand the sport globally and create new value within the golf ecosystem while enhancing the social impact of the game. A historic investment by LIV Golf also launched The International Series, a set of 10 enhanced Asian Tour-sanctioned events with elevated prize funds in world-class destinations, offering a pathway for top professional and amateur golfers from around the world to the LIV Golf League.
